Alkylphenols

Alkylphenols are widely used industrial chemicals often found in plastics, cosmetics, detergents, paints, pesticides, and cleaning products. They are highly toxic and have been linked to several endocrine disorders. The alkylphenols include BPA, triclosan and 4-nonylphenol.

Tips for Avoidance

  • Avoid polycarbonate containers that contain BPA #3 or #7
  • Look for BPA-free cans and containers and reduce your use of canned food
  • Opt for glass, porcelain or stainless steel containers, especially for hot foods and liquids
  • Avoid handling store receipts – they contain BPA
  • Use BPA-free baby bottles
  • Do not microwave plastic food containers. EVER!
  • To minimize 4-nonylphenol exposure, do not heat food in plastic wrap

Chlorinated Pesticides

Chlorinated pesticides were first placed into wide-spread agricultural use after World War II. Of the chlorinated pesticides, DDT is the most well-known. These powerful mitochondrial toxins bioaccumulate in our bodies, increasing our toxic burden and often cause chronic illness. Chlorinated pesticides include DDT, DDE, Dieldrin, Heptachlor Epoxide, Hexachlorobenzene, Mirex, Oxychlordane, and trans-nonachlor.

Tips for Avoidance

  • Avoid food found to contain high levels of pesticides (Check out the dirty dozen and clean fifteen list provided by the Environmental Working Group)
  • Avoid non-organic butter – high in DDE, HCB
  • Avoid farmed Atlantic salmon – high in DDE, dieldrin, HCB, mirex
  • Avoid non-organic greens (spinach, collards, dirty dozen) – high in DDE
  • Avoid non-organic cheese (cream cheddar, American) as they contain DDE, dieldrin, HCB
  • Avoid non-organic fatty meats (lamb, ground beef) – DDE, HCB

Plasticizers and Preservatives

Phthalates are compounds added to plastic to make it more flexible. These compounds are also added as stabilizers to other products. Phthalates are easily released as plastic ages, accelerating the release of these chemicals. Most Americans tested by the Centers for Disease Control have metabolites of multiple phthalates in their urine. The Plasticizers and Preservatives include Phthalates MEHHP, MEHP, MEOHP, MEtP & Parabens Butylpraben, Ethylparaben, Methylparaben, and Propylparaben.

Volatile Organic Compounds

Volatile organic compounds are emitted as gases from certain solids or liquids. Concentrations of many VOCs are consistently higher indoors (up to ten times higher) than outdoors. VOCs are emitted by a wide array of products and are widely used as ingredients in household products. Paints, varnishes, wax, disinfectants, cosmetics, degreasing and hobby products. Volatile Organic compounds include Benzene, Ethylbenzene, Styrene, Toluene, and Xylenes.

Tips for Avoidance

  • Keep the area well ventilated when working with any type of volatile solvent
  • Avoid use of indoor air fresheners
  • Avoid breathing household cleaning products and use non-toxic cleaners
  • Avoid heating foods in styrofoam containers
